AP Information
Benefits of AP Courses:
College level information
Weighted Credit
Possible college credit (depending on what you score on the exam)
Courses you have been preparing for while being in Pre-AP courses
What is weighted credit?
Grades earned in weighted classes will earn an extra grade point. Therefore, an “A” in a weighted class will yield 5-grade points (4 points for the “A” and 1 more point as a weighted “bonus”), a “B” will yield 4-grade points, and a “C” will yield 3-grade points, etc. Weighted credit is possible regardless of your score on the exam, BUT you MUST take the exam to earn the weighted credit. Weighted credit will be removed for students who take an AP course and do not take the exam.
College Credit/Sending Scores
If you score a 3 or higher on your AP exam, most colleges consider giving you college credit for that class. It is important to indicate on your pre-exam paperwork where you want your scores sent. If you do not send your scores to colleges before the exam, much like the ACT, you will have to pay to send them later. If you scored well and would like to send your scores to your college of choice, you will need to log in to your college board account and send them.
